Air fares to Goa fly high on Dussehra weekend rush

Panaji: Air fares for the Dussehra weekend over a fortnight away have already begun spiralling. While it will cost nearly double the regular fare for October to fly into Goa from the metros, on the Sunday following the Hindu festival, it will cost over three times to fly out of Goa.

Dussehra falls on a Thursday, October 22, this year and one day of leave can offer employees an extended weekend of four days up to Sunday.

Flyers cannot hope to purchase a ticket at a lower price on the eve of Dussehra, as on October 21 too airlines have hiked prices.

An air ticket to Delhi can be bought for 3,990 on other days in October, but on October 22, it will cost a minimum of 7,551. To fly back home on October 25, the Delhiite will pay a minimum of 10,960.
